The Geffen Playhouse will be slightly expanding its real-estate footprint this weekend with the opening of a new educational facility called the Geffen Playhouse Kinross Annex.

Located in Westwood Village on Kinross Avenue, the new storefront space will serve as a home for the Geffen’s resident education partner, the Story Pirates, which produces youth-oriented theater and other programs.The first performance in the space is scheduled for 2 p.m. Saturday.

Advertisement

Story Pirates was founded in 2003 in New York to help disadvantaged students through arts programs centered around literacy and theater. The group will use the Geffen’s new space to work and rehearse their in-school creative writing and drama programs, as well as to hold weekly performances, workshops and classes that are open to the community.

The Geffen said that it began its Story Pirates partnership in 2009 as a way to expand the resources of the theater’s current in-school initiatives

The annex is approximately 1,100 square feet and features a theater space with about 40 seats. A sign for the annex is not ready yet, but a spokeswoman for the Geffen said they expect it to be in place within a couple of weeks.

Gil Cates, producing director of the Geffen, said the theater company is leasing the space ‘at a good price’ on behalf of Story Pirates. He said that the project, like much of the Geffen’s activities, is largely donor-driven and that he hopes it will be ongoing.

Cates said he was generally upbeat about the Geffen’s financial health. ‘This is not to say it’s not without challenges,’ he added.

One of the company’s ongoing challenges is an endowment drive that has been in the works but has not yet launched. Cates said he couldn’t provide a launch date for the drive. He has stated in a past interview that the endowment drive would launch when the overall fundraising environment has improved.
